Output 98e5205abf84f18a606b0f18c877ef7b5951180536d0d9aafa42717558ea2c4a:0

value
1039217800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50cab30054e65be03a9053b76aac7bba568b640a OP_EQUALVERIFY OP_CHECKSIG
address
18NBt8rWz6F6f4mGp4FH8uJRvNq8W9FkEG
transaction
98e5205abf84f18a606b0f18c877ef7b5951180536d0d9aafa42717558ea2c4a
spent
true